From e6935876b97a63bae2ec087b4fc390c832aef155 Mon Sep 17 00:00:00 2001
From: James Moger <james.moger@gitblit.com>
Date: Thu, 22 Dec 2011 17:06:35 -0500
Subject: [PATCH] Drop recent activity y-axis labels

---
 src/com/gitblit/build/Build.java |   67 ++++++++++++++++++++-------------
 1 files changed, 41 insertions(+), 26 deletions(-)

diff --git a/src/com/gitblit/build/Build.java b/src/com/gitblit/build/Build.java
index 6ca8cb6..8ca52c3 100644
--- a/src/com/gitblit/build/Build.java
+++ b/src/com/gitblit/build/Build.java
@@ -48,11 +48,11 @@
  * 
  */
 public class Build {
-	
+
 	public interface DownloadListener {
 		public void downloading(String name);
 	}
-	
+
 	/**
 	 * BuildType enumeration representing compile-time or runtime. This is used
 	 * to download dependencies either for Gitblit GO runtime or for setting up
@@ -61,7 +61,7 @@
 	public static enum BuildType {
 		RUNTIME, COMPILETIME;
 	}
-	
+
 	private static DownloadListener downloadListener;
 
 	public static void main(String... args) {
@@ -89,6 +89,7 @@
 		downloadFromApache(MavenObject.JDOM, BuildType.RUNTIME);
 		downloadFromApache(MavenObject.GSON, BuildType.RUNTIME);
 		downloadFromApache(MavenObject.MAIL, BuildType.RUNTIME);
+		downloadFromApache(MavenObject.GROOVY, BuildType.RUNTIME);
 
 		downloadFromEclipse(MavenObject.JGIT, BuildType.RUNTIME);
 		downloadFromEclipse(MavenObject.JGIT_HTTP, BuildType.RUNTIME);
@@ -114,14 +115,15 @@
 		downloadFromApache(MavenObject.JDOM, BuildType.COMPILETIME);
 		downloadFromApache(MavenObject.GSON, BuildType.COMPILETIME);
 		downloadFromApache(MavenObject.MAIL, BuildType.COMPILETIME);
-
+		downloadFromApache(MavenObject.GROOVY, BuildType.COMPILETIME);
+		
 		downloadFromEclipse(MavenObject.JGIT, BuildType.COMPILETIME);
 		downloadFromEclipse(MavenObject.JGIT_HTTP, BuildType.COMPILETIME);
 
 		// needed for site publishing
 		downloadFromApache(MavenObject.COMMONSNET, BuildType.RUNTIME);
 	}
-	
+
 	public static void federationClient() {
 		downloadFromApache(MavenObject.JCOMMANDER, BuildType.RUNTIME);
 		downloadFromApache(MavenObject.SERVLET, BuildType.RUNTIME);
@@ -131,15 +133,17 @@
 		downloadFromApache(MavenObject.LOG4J, BuildType.RUNTIME);
 		downloadFromApache(MavenObject.GSON, BuildType.RUNTIME);
 		downloadFromApache(MavenObject.JSCH, BuildType.RUNTIME);
-		
+
 		downloadFromEclipse(MavenObject.JGIT, BuildType.RUNTIME);
 	}
-	
-	public static void rpcClient(DownloadListener listener) {
+
+	public static void manager(DownloadListener listener) {
 		downloadListener = listener;
 		downloadFromApache(MavenObject.GSON, BuildType.RUNTIME);
+		downloadFromApache(MavenObject.ROME, BuildType.RUNTIME);
+		downloadFromApache(MavenObject.JDOM, BuildType.RUNTIME);
 		downloadFromApache(MavenObject.JSCH, BuildType.RUNTIME);
-		
+
 		downloadFromEclipse(MavenObject.JGIT, BuildType.RUNTIME);
 	}
 
@@ -288,7 +292,7 @@
 				}
 			}
 			if (downloadListener != null) {
-				downloadListener.downloading(mo.name);
+				downloadListener.downloading(mo.name + "...");
 			}
 			ByteArrayOutputStream buff = new ByteArrayOutputStream();
 			try {
@@ -310,10 +314,17 @@
 					if (progress - lastProgress >= 0.1f) {
 						lastProgress = progress;
 						updateDownload(progress, targetFile);
+						if (downloadListener != null) {
+							int percent = Math.min(100, Math.round(100 * progress));
+							downloadListener.downloading(mo.name + " (" + percent + "%)");
+						}
 					}
 				}
 				in.close();
 				updateDownload(1f, targetFile);
+				if (downloadListener != null) {
+					downloadListener.downloading(mo.name + " (100%)");
+				}
 
 			} catch (IOException e) {
 				throw new RuntimeException("Error downloading " + mavenURL + " to " + targetFile, e);
@@ -401,22 +412,22 @@
 				"78aa1cbf0fa3b259abdc7d87f9f6788d785aac2a");
 
 		public static final MavenObject WICKET = new MavenObject("Apache Wicket",
-				"org/apache/wicket", "wicket", "1.4.18", 1960000, 1906000, 6818000,
-				"921a50dbbebdf034f0042f2294760e7535cb7041",
-				"b432d60b32449fdfb216ac23af8a3ed3e0a3368c",
-				"435e70f9de94975ee30c3f1b1aa1401aea9b4e70");
+				"org/apache/wicket", "wicket", "1.4.19", 1960000, 1906000, 6818000,
+				"7e6af5cadaf6c9b7e068e45cf2ffbea3cc91592f",
+				"5e91cf00efaf2fedeef98e13464a4230e5966588",
+				"5dde8afbe5eb2314a704cb74938c1b651b2cf190");
 
 		public static final MavenObject WICKET_EXT = new MavenObject("Apache Wicket Extensions",
-				"org/apache/wicket", "wicket-extensions", "1.4.18", 1180000, 1118000, 1458000,
-				"f568bd2ad382db935ab06fdccfdead3f10ed1f15",
-				"c00a4979d7647d3367c6e4897a2fd7d0f78a73cc",
-				"5e76ab69f6307e3ecb2638779008b3adf5cbf9aa");
+				"org/apache/wicket", "wicket-extensions", "1.4.19", 1180000, 1118000, 1458000,
+				"c7a1d343e216cdc2e692b6fabc6eaeca9aa24ca4",
+				"6c2e2ad89b69fc9977c24467e3aa0d7f6c75a579",
+				"3a3082fb106173f7ca069a6f5969cc8d347d9f44");
 
 		public static final MavenObject WICKET_AUTH_ROLES = new MavenObject(
-				"Apache Wicket Auth Roles", "org/apache/wicket", "wicket-auth-roles", "1.4.18",
-				44000, 45000, 166000, "44cf0647e1adca377cc4258cd7fac33aa1dd11ab",
-				"2a7e9c6a9687136c2527afa2e53148cfa82696c6",
-				"6e280995097e84b72b283132b8fe6796595caa38");
+				"Apache Wicket Auth Roles", "org/apache/wicket", "wicket-auth-roles", "1.4.19",
+				44000, 45000, 166000, "70c26ac4cd167bf7323372d2d49eb2a9beff73b9",
+				"ca219726c1768a9483e4a0bb6550881babfe46d6",
+				"17753908f8a9e997c464a69765b4682126fa1fd6");
 
 		public static final MavenObject WICKET_GOOGLE_CHARTS = new MavenObject(
 				"Apache Wicket Google Charts Add-On", "org/wicketstuff", "googlecharts", "1.4.18",
@@ -428,10 +439,10 @@
 				237000, 0, 0, "c94f54227b08100974c36170dcb53329435fe5ad", "", "");
 
 		public static final MavenObject MARKDOWNPAPERS = new MavenObject("MarkdownPapers",
-				"org/tautua/markdownpapers", "markdownpapers-core", "1.1.1", 87000, 58000, 278000,
-				"07046e6d8f33866398dfc3955698925df9ff7719",
-				"178b49c34dbab6301ce848b67e7957bcf9b94d6a",
-				"160d370f6cb119a1b46a00f37cc28d23fd27daed");
+				"org/tautua/markdownpapers", "markdownpapers-core", "1.2.5", 87000, 58000, 268000,
+				"295910b1893d73d4803f9ea2790ee1d10c466364",
+				"2170f358f29886aea8794c4bfdb6f1b27b152b9b",
+				"481599f34cb2abe4a9ebc771d8d81823375ec1ce");
 
 		public static final MavenObject BOUNCYCASTLE = new MavenObject("BouncyCastle",
 				"org/bouncycastle", "bcprov-jdk16", "1.46", 1900000, 1400000, 4670000,
@@ -486,6 +497,10 @@
 				"1.4.3", 462000, 642000, 0, "8154bf8d666e6db154c548dc31a8d512c273f5ee",
 				"5875e2729de83a4e46391f8f979ec8bd03810c10", null);
 
+		public static final MavenObject GROOVY = new MavenObject("groovy", "org/codehaus/groovy", "groovy-all",
+				"1.8.4", 6143000, 2290000, 4608000, "b5e7c2a5e6af43ccccf643ad656d6fe4b773be2b",
+				"a527e83e5c715540108d8f2b86ca19a3c9c78ac1", "8e5da5584fff57b14adbb4ee25cca09f5a00b013");
+
 		public final String name;
 		public final String group;
 		public final String artifact;

--
Gitblit v1.9.1